Database Trial – Scopus (Elsevier)
by
•The University of Wisconsin System is currently conducting a trial of Scopus from Elsevier. Scopus is a large, multidisciplinary abstract and citation database covering the sciences, social sciences, and humanities. It provides tools for tracking, analyzing, and visualizing search results.
